Barge 570 departs Point Barrow, Alaska, after unloading supplies and equipment during COOL BARGE '88. COOL BARGE operations, through which remote government sites in Alaska are resupplied, are managed by the Air Force's Water Port Logistics Office in Seattle. The actual delivery of supplies is handled by APUTCO, a civilian contractor
